The best racing game available outside of Forza Motorsport 6 (and a great deal cheaper, I might add). That might change with the impending release of Gran Turismo Sport but overall this is a very well put together and underrated game. The customization options are more abundant than I've ever seen in a video game, especially on console. Note, however, it is a serious racing game. Don't buy expecting an arcade game (NFS, The Crew, Forza Horizon). Project CARS has a more underwhelming lineup of cars compared to its Forza competitors, and all of it his accessed by some unusual and confusing--but not dysfunctional--menus. This game is a godsend for car-enthusiasts.; the game that looks and feels (and sounds) like you are really shredding pavement.

Project Cars has a great variety of cars and tracks, all rendered with great graphics. I love sim racing, but the handling model of this game is a bit dodgy. It feels like ice. Even high-downforce cars break free too easily. Plus it's almost mandatory to have a wheel with this game. It doesn't work well with a controller. I spent hours online searching for and finding good settings for a controller, and even then, it's not optimal. Assetto Corsa isn't as pretty and offers fewer cars and tracks, but it has a better handling model and works well with a controller.
